Anaconda 安裝tensorflow中的FutureWaring的問題

在使用命令 pip install --upgrade --ignore-installed tensorflow-gpu安裝完tensorflow-gpu後,查看是否安裝成功,出現futureWaring錯誤,錯誤如下:

在這裏插入圖片描述
C:\ProgramData\Anaconda3\envs\tensorflow\lib\site-packages\tensorflow\python\ framework\dtypes.py:516: FutureWarning: Passing (type, 1) or ‘1type’ as a synonym of type is deprecated; in a future version of numpy, it will be understood as (type, (1,)) / ‘(1,)type’.
_np_qint8 = np.dtype([(“qint8”, np.int8, 1)])

大意就是:FutureWarning,不推薦使用(type,1)或’1type’作爲類型的同義詞; 在未來的numpy版本中,它將被理解爲(type,(1,))/’(1,)type’

這是由於numpy的版本導致的

1.升級版本,但顯示已經是最新版本了
在這裏插入圖片描述=
2.降低版本,上述顯示numpy的版本爲1.17.0,把版本降低爲1.16.4
在這裏插入圖片描述
再次導入tensorflow模塊,futureWaring消失
在這裏插入圖片描述

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章